搜档网
当前位置:搜档网 › 经纬度转换

经纬度转换

度分秒转换经纬度 / 经纬度转换工具,从excel到google地图 2010-08-28 00:54:00| 分类: 电脑技术 | 标签: |字号大中小 订阅 .

一、经纬度的转化
1、MID:返回文本串 指定位置开始的特殊数目的字符
=(MID(B1,1,3))+MID(B1,5,2)/60+MID(B1,8,2)/3600+MID(B1,11,2)/21600

比如,B1是“038 45 02.00E”,则结果显示“38.7505555555556”



=(MID(C20,1,2))+MID(C20,4,2)/60+MID(C20,7,2)/3600

比如,C20是“38度44分46秒”,则结果显示“38.7461111111111”




2、INT:将任意实数向下取整为最接近的整数
Round:四舍五入到某位数
=INT(A1)&"度"&INT((A1-INT(A1))*60)&"分"&ROUND(((A1-INT(A1))*60-INT((A1-INT(A1))*60))*60,0)&"秒"

比如,A1是109.90581,则结果显示“109度54分21秒”



二、经纬度转换工具,从excel到google地图

1、必须使用软件:ExceltoKml.exe,若没有可发邮件给我 lin2x@https://www.sodocs.net/doc/f416670630.html,

2、软件的目的是,将excel2003文档格式转换成google地图格式kml

3、excel文档的第一列:站点名;第二列:经度;第三列:纬度;第四列:站点描述。excel文档的第一栏和第一列,就必须是站点数据,不得有其他描述性的数据,否则无法转换

4、经纬度的数据,必须是如“38.7461111”这种含小数点格式的数据,如果是“度分秒”格式的,请参照上头公式先行转换,否则无法使用转换软件。

5、ExceltoKml仅对excel文档的第一个工作表有效,且与工作表名称无关。excel必须是2003版本的。

相关主题